What Causes Black Bowel Movement After Gallbladder Removal?

Hello,
My partner had his gallbladder out in December. He has had nothing but problems since. We have found out that he has PCS at his last visit to A&E. but is having runny black stools which has been going on for a few weeks. He is now eating small meals as he lost his appetite but I'm getting him to drink plenty of water. He is being sick and is very lethargic all the time so is sleeping lots.
Please can you advise
Thank you

Thanks for raising your concern and after reviewing your case history I'm of the following opinion:

1. are you taking any iron supplements or bismuth preparation which can cause black stools
2. chronic diarrhea is a complication with PCS but if they are black and you have ruled out every dietary/medicine possibility then it will be wise to see a Gastroenterologist for colonoscopy and stool for occult blood.

PS. blood mixed stool indicates either some intestinal problem,injury or infection, as such see your attending doctor immediately since it requires a proper examination and evaluation.

3. If vitals are abnormal [lethargic,sleeping a lot,lost appetite] then immediate admission is needed
